Description
InterContinental Melbourne The Rialto is situated on Collins Street at the heart of the city’s banking precinct.
To access its 253 luxury guestrooms and suites, its two restaurants, and its rooftop leisure facilities, one enters via a nineteenth-century Venetian Gothic façade, an architectural feature that embodies both artistic endeavour and commercial activity.
The InterContinental’s collaborative relationship with Mainartery now spans eight years, across which time a lease arrangement has facilitated the display of world class sculpture through their historic lobby, through their lounge bar, and through their two fine-dining restaurants.
The lease arrangement allows for the ongoing integration of sculpture, while also ensuring that new selections of sculpture arrive according to a prearranged plan: a function that introduces an element of freshness and surprise that would not be possible with a small selection of purchased works.
